Hopewell High School Locked Down Tuesday Due To Police Activity

The school was placed on lockdown around lunchtime Tuesday.

12:09 p.m. UPDATE: The reason for the lockdown was a person reported seeing someone with a firearm near the high school according to police.

HUNTERSVILLE, NC — Hopewell High School is on lockdown as of 11:30 a.m. Tuesday due to police activity according to an alert sent to parents.

The school system sent that notice to students and parents just before lunchtime notifying them of the lockdown, per WSOC.

This is the same high school prompting parents to speak out tonightat the CMS board meeting about school safety following a fight involving five students last week. A firearm was discovered during that altercation.
